Output de7c5846d16bc3c2509075b11ba617f608032780d0ffb9802184d04d4cbc163f:137

value
75084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73843b4b0c9d01b4a9e6a2f43a28d62ac9a0ffa3 OP_EQUAL
address
3CDp3Db82vMRo2AxG63vPNzi39Yz7gcD69
transaction
de7c5846d16bc3c2509075b11ba617f608032780d0ffb9802184d04d4cbc163f